    Desktop Pulse 1.0


    Deliver Internet content straight onto your desktop with Desktop Pulse!

    Desktop Pulse is a freeware utility which can automatically download .jpg and .gif images and put them onto your desktop as wallpaper. You can setup as many pictures as you want. Choose the frequency of update, change the sequnce of the pictures. Using Desktop Pulse, you can constanly monitor stock exhange graphs, monitor any pictures (like webcams) or simply put nice wallpapers onto your desktop every minute!

    FEATURES
    At the moment Desktop Pulse has the following features:
    • Easy install/uninstall
    • Support for .gif and .jpg files
    • Using unlimited number of pictures and rotating them
    • Adjustable frequency of downloads
    • Adjustable modes: Center, Mosaic or Full Screen
    System Requirements:

    Desktop Pulse 1.0 [​IMG]PC with Pentium processor or better
    Desktop Pulse 1.0 [​IMG]Windows 95, 98, ME, NT, 2000, or XP
